Transaction 5808043c75004cda735f9411a383eeea481e46aaadba7ac5c33a1a68d1f8544a

2 Input
2 Outputs
  • 5808043c75004cda735f9411a383eeea481e46aaadba7ac5c33a1a68d1f8544a:0
  • value  1908355
    address  33pH5LsrdUqB7UCFMTYgFgDBj2SpvmZdpc
  • 5808043c75004cda735f9411a383eeea481e46aaadba7ac5c33a1a68d1f8544a:1
  • value  113196
    address  3HmNreAypnh1agKb6dq5oMd9ov56qo7RTh